2025/11/02 12:42 Stop Microsoft users sending 'reactions' to email by adding a postfix header

やあ、ロボ子。今日はOutlookのリアクション通知を止める方法について話すのじゃ。

Outlookのリアクション通知ですか? あれ、結構邪魔に感じることがありますね。

そうじゃろ? そこで、Postfixに`x-ms-reactions: disallow`というヘッダーを追加して、リアクションを抑制するのじゃ。

なるほど、メールヘッダーで制御するんですね。具体的にはどうやるんですか?

まず、Postfixの設定ファイル`/etc/postfix/main.cf`に`header_checks = pcre:/etc/postfix/header_checks`を設定するのじゃ。

はい、設定ファイルですね。

次に、`/etc/postfix/header_checks`に`/^Date:/i PREPEND x-ms-reactions: disallow`を追加して、Postfixを再起動するのじゃ。

`Date`ヘッダーがあるメールに`x-ms-reactions: disallow`を追加する、と。

その通り! これでOutlookのリアクションをブロックできるはず…なんじゃが、ちょっと注意が必要なのじゃ。

注意点ですか?

テストの結果、ヘッダーを追加しても、リアクションが届いてしまう場合と、無効になる場合があることがわかったのじゃ。

え、そうなんですか。完全にブロックできるわけではないんですね。

そう。Microsoftは、クライアント側の表示に関わらず、サーバー側でリアクションを拒否する可能性があることを示唆しているのじゃ。

サーバー側で拒否されるなら、ヘッダーを追加しても意味がない場合もあるんですね。

まあ、試してみる価値はあるぞ。完全に防げなくても、少しは減らせるかもしれんし。

そうですね。やってみる価値はありそうです。でも、根本的な解決にはならないかもしれない、と。

そういうことじゃ。Microsoft様の気まぐれには、いつも振り回されるのじゃ…まるで、私の研究室の冷蔵庫の中身みたいに予測不能じゃ!

博士の冷蔵庫は、確かにカオスですね…
⚠️この記事は生成AIによるコンテンツを含み、ハルシネーションの可能性があります。
